A Fireside Chat on the Modernization of Medical Affairs Influencing HCP Behavior in a Newly Virtual World

Webcast

Webcasts

Now available on demand! Medical affairs is a high visibility role with a heavy lift to both to engage the right HCPs and KOLs as well as bring strategic, data-driven value to their organizations. But what no one saw coming was a pandemic that would change everything: the ways MSLs prepared; engaged; and strategized as well as an enhanced focus on driving HCP behavior that will have real-life downstream impact on patient outcomes. It’s a tall order. Join us to discuss what happened, where it’s going and how measurable impact has shifted.

Kristin Cova, PharmD
Director, Regional Medical Advisors
Myovant Sciences

Kristin is the Director of Regional Medical Liaisons at Myovant Sciences. Her team is responsible for coordinating field medical support and fostering strategic relationships with stakeholders. She has worked in several therapeutic areas and taken on roles of increasing responsibility including MSL Field Manager, Global Stakeholder Relations Director, and MSL Director. Kristin’s expertise in Medical Affairs includes KOL identification and development, new product launches, and cross-functional team communications.

Prior to industry, Kristin spent 13 years in clinical pharmacy practice. She holds a PharmD. from Duquesne University in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ania.
